Position at Danbury Hospital
Summary :
Responsible for all accountabilities of the Patient Access Liaison 1. Provides functional guidance to staff. Performs registration and admitting functions and communicates information on financial obligations to both in-patients and out-patients to ensure a "one touch" registration / scheduling experience. Provides estimates for services when appropriate. Receives and processes patient financial liability payments.
Responsibilities :
1. Performs all responsibilities of the Patient Access Liaison 1 position. May provide functional guidance to Patient Access Liaison 1 employees 2. Communicates all information pertaining to the patient's financial obligations, including but not limited to co-payments, deductibles, in and out of network responsibilities, referrals and authorizations. Requires an understanding of payor requirements and state and federal collection laws and regulations. 3. Completes all admitting functions. When applicable duties may include bed management responsibilities utilizing the ED bed management application. 4. Facilitates in gathering accurate patient billing information. Ensures that proper selection of insurance, plan type, prioritization, pre-certification and billing address are assigned in the system utilizing a broad knowledge of insurance as well as regulatory and contractual compliance. 5. Performs collections of outstanding accounts receivable. Accurately estimates the patient liability. (copayments, deductibles, coinsurances, deposits, etc. via obtaining accurate demographic and financial information). 6. Receives and processes patient payments. Maintains necessary petty cash to properly service and receive payments. 7. Answers patient inquiries regarding their liability and able to explain the variables involved. 8. Properly receipts and forwards all copies of patient payment receipts posting to the patient's account in appropriate system. 9. Performs end of day duties closing and reconciliation duties in appropriate system and reconcile deposit slips. 10. Fulfills all compliance responsibilities related to the position. 11. Performs other duties as assigned.
